**Runbook 7.3 — Account recovery, Fareloom rules engine**

If the shipping-fee rules admin account gets locked (usually after a failed bulk import), don't panic — the rules keep evaluating from cache for six hours. As release manager you can trigger recovery from the ops console: pick the Fareloom tenant, hit "Restore Admin," and confirm the maintenance window. The console will then prompt for the recovery passphrase, which is below.

unlock words, yawig-kagef: gordor-holvan-ulaael-pramir-ulaiel-tamdor

### Hot-Reloading Config

The Copperjay gateway picks up config changes without a restart — just push to the config endpoint and watchers apply it within seconds. Handy for support when tweaking rate limits mid-incident, but heads up: malformed payloads are rejected silently, so always check the reload status route afterward. That endpoint requires authentication with the internal key below.

API key for fahip-kahip: zpat23_XiJGUHz5xfaAtaIqUkus0rh

## Tuning

Welcome aboard! The Cratewise optimizer mostly runs fine out of the box, but every warehouse layout is a little different. The big levers are aisle-crossing penalty and batch size — nudge those first before touching anything else, and always re-run the Dellhaven benchmark after changes. Here are the defaults we ship with.

tuning table, faweg-bajep:
WEIGHTS = {
    "belius": 690,
    "eliox": 458,
    "norax": 616,
    "praion": 132,
    "zorvan": 911,
}

Welcome to on-call for the Glimmerpane design system! Our snapshot tests live in the `snapcheck` suite and run on every merge to main. If a UI component changes visually, the diff bot flags it — usually it's an intentional tweak, so just approve the new baseline. If it's 2am and snapshots are failing across the board, it's almost always a font-loading race, not your problem. To unlock the baseline store and re-approve snapshots in bulk, use the recovery passphrase below.

recovery phrase for tahag-taguf: wenix-caswyn